WHEREAS, $300,000,000 of aggregate principal amount of the Notes is outstanding as of the date hereof;

WHEREAS, Section 9.02 of the Original Indenture provides that, with the consent of the Holders of at least a majority of principal amount of the Notes then outstanding, the Company and the Trustee may enter into an indenture supplemental to the Indenture for the purpose of amending or supplementing the Indenture or the Notes (subject to certain exceptions);

WHEREAS, the Company desires and has requested the Trustee to join with them and the Guarantors in entering into this Thirty-First Supplemental Indenture for the purpose of amending the Indenture and the Notes in certain respects as permitted by Section 9.02 of the Original Indenture;

WHEREAS, Lennar Corporation, on behalf of the Company, has been soliciting consents to this Thirty-First Supplemental Indenture upon the terms and subject to the conditions set forth in the Offering Memorandum and Consent Solicitation Statement (herein so called) of Lennar Corporation dated January 19, 2018 and the related Letter of Transmittal and Consent (which together, including any amendments, modifications, or supplements thereto, govern the “Consent Solicitation” for the Notes);

WHEREAS, (1) the Company has received the consent of the Holders of at least majority in principal amount of the outstanding Notes, all as certified by an Officers’ Certificate delivered to the Trustee simultaneously with the execution and delivery of this Thirty-First Supplemental Indenture, and (2) the Company has delivered to the Trustee simultaneously with the execution and delivery of this Thirty-First Supplemental Indenture an Opinion of Counsel relating to this Thirty-First Supplemental Indenture as contemplated by Section 10.04 of the Indenture; and

WHEREAS, all things necessary to make this Thirty-First Supplemental Indenture a valid agreement of the Company and the Trustee, in accordance with its terms, and a valid amendment of, and supplement to, the Indenture have been done.

ARTICLE I

Amendment to Indentures and Notes

SECTION 1.01. Amendments to Articles Five, Six and Seven.

(a) The Indenture is hereby amended by deleting the following Sections or clauses of the Twentieth Supplemental Indenture and all references and definitions to the extent solely related thereto in their entirety and replacing each such Section or clause, as applicable, with “[Intentionally Omitted]”:

 

- 2 -


(i) Section 6.01(Compliance with Securities Laws);

(ii) Section 6.02 (Restrictions on Secured Indebtedness);

(iii) Section 6.03 (Restrictions on Sale and Leaseback Transactions);

(iv) Section 6.04 (Designation of Restricted and Unrestricted Subsidiaries);

(v) Clause (b) (no default or event of default) of Section 6.05 (Merger and Sales of Assets by the Company);

(vi) Section 6.06 (Reports to Holders of the Notes);

(vii) Section 6.07 (Future Subsidiary Guarantees); and

(viii) Clauses (i) (cross-default to other indebtedness) and (ii) (judgment defaults) of Section 7.01 (Additional Events of Default).

(b) The Indenture is hereby amended by rendering the provisions of the following Sections and clauses of the Original Indenture and all references and definitions to the extent solely related thereto inapplicable to the Notes:

(i) Clause (1) (requiring any successor of a merger or transferee of assets to be a corporation organized and existing under the laws of the United States or a State thereof) of Section 5.01 (When Company May Merge, etc.) but solely applying to the requirement for any successor of a merger or consolidation or transferee of assets to (x) be a corporation and (y) be organized under the laws of the United States or a State thereof;

(ii) Clause (2) (no default or event of default) of Section 5.01 (When Company May Merge, etc.);

(iii) Clause (3) (default as a failure to comply with covenants other than covenants to pay interest, principal or premium) of Section 6.01 (Events of Default);

(iv) Clause (4) (commencement of a voluntary bankruptcy case) of Section 6.01 (Events of Default); and

(v) Clause (5) (commencement of an involuntary bankruptcy case) of Section 6.01 (Events of Default).

(c) Section 6.05(a) (Merger and Sales of Assets by the Company) of the Indenture is hereby amended and restated in its entirety to read as follows: “(a) such Person (if other than the Company) expressly assumes all the obligations of the Company under the Indenture and the Notes; and”.
